Boston University’s weekly Walter Rodney seminars are held Mondays in the B.U. African Studies Center. This week’s seminar features Jeanne Koopman, Visiting Researcher in Economics at Boston University, presenting “A Senegalese Rural Development Project Stumbles Badly after 20 Years of Success: A Long-time Observer Attempts an Analysis.”
